The Strait of Johor separates 2 nations.


One is blessed with every possible natural resources you name it and another has nothing but a strategic port.


Few decades to come the world has evolved, Singapore today enjoys as the most livable place in Asia, 4th leading financial centre, most globalised country in the world, 2nd busiest ports after Shanghai, most competitive nation, GDP (nominal) per capital of $37,293 (year 2009) and the list goes on...


While we are trapped in the middle-income group the lion has moved forward.


Read the book, "From 3rd World to 1st" by Lee Kuan Yew and it's not hard to know why. I read through the book in my matriculation days and it impressed me!


And one cannot deny the contributions made by the late Dr Goh Keng Swee (6 October 1918 - 14 May 2010) in creating a modern economy that is so vibrant focused on industry, education and urban planning.


He played a vital role in the places we were going to visit.


The URA (Urban Redevelopment Authority) and Jurong. He was the master brain for Jurong Industrial Estate , once a laughing stock and now attracted billions of foreign investments into this city-state.

SMALL ISLAND BIG PLANS

URA is Singapore national land-use planning authority. It prepares long-termed strategic plans, as well as detailed local area plans, coordinates and guides efforts to bring these plans into reality.

Everyone of us knows Singapore is small!

But how small ?

It's only about 2.5 times Penang Island (293km2) as Singapore (710.2km2) has limited lands for a 5 million populations.

Every inch of the land counts! It has the highest population density in the world after Monaco yet the land use is so well planned!

Guess what, Singapore plans for the next 40 - 50 years ahead! Amazing huh?







The concept plan maps out vision for the next 4 to 5 decades to come, especially in land use and transportation plan.

The plan is put together with extensive public consultation through internet feedback, public dialogues and exhibition.


Master plan guides Singapore's development over the next 10 - 15 years, aligning to the Concept Plan big direction.

Transform the Jurong Lakeside




As you step into URA, you'll be welcome by this single large Jurong Lakeside model.

URA announced a masterplan in April 2008 to transform Jurong into the largest commercial hub outside city centre in the next 10 years.


No more just an industrial place


*New world-class science centre
*New lakeside village
*Enhanced Chinese Garden and Japanese Garden
*New Public Park
*JCube - New shopping mall with Olympic-size ice skating rink (ready in 2012)
